What Is Digital Accessibility?

Digital accessibility means ensuring digital products, platforms, and websites are usable by all individuals, including those with disabilities. This includes compatibility with assistive technologies and adherence to recognized accessibility standards.

Journey Payroll & HR (“Journey”) is committed to creating inclusive, accessible digital experiences consistent with:

  • The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) Title III (public‑facing technologies)

  • Section 508 of the Rehabilitation Act (where applicable to federal contractors and public entities)

  • State‑level accessibility requirements, including:

    • Colorado HB21‑1110 (Accessibility Law)

    • California Unruh Civil Rights Act

    • Other state nondiscrimination laws

  • The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 Level A and AA, published by the W3C
